Abstract:
Abstract The real number system $$\mathbb{R}$$ has a long and august history spanning a host of civilizations over a period of many centuries [17]. It may be considered the rock upon which many other mathematical systems are constructed and, at the same time, serves as a model of desirable properties that any extension of the real numbers should have.
